Bonaire is set up for...solely...divers. There is little to do above the water. There are over 65 shore diving sites so the cost of a boat can be totally eliminated if one desires....yet there are boats there if that is what you want too.

Not sure what the cost diff would be but you could do Bonaire for under 3K probably pretty easily.

Like Rich, I have not been to Belize so I can't give you any help there. On the other hand, I have spent a lot of time on Bonaire. The diving is very easy,the people are great and there is plenty of good food on the island. The water and food are safe to eat. You are not likely to see many large fish or animals but mid to small fish are everywhere. It's a sleepy island with limited topside activities. If all you want to do is dive, eat and sleep it's the place. Rich's $3k is for 2, depending on where you live you can easly do a week on Bonaire for $1500pp unless you like fancy accomidations or like to run up a big bar tab.

We've been to both + times. And liked both. But, we like Belize a whole lot better !. That said, Why ? A number of different reasons, mainly larger and more fish in Belize. We've done both shore and live aboard there. I especially liked Blackbird. The cabins were nice, food good and diving was fun. Saltwater crocs too.

Another thing about Belize that we've come to like is - after a weeks diving we take a few more days on the mainland, stay at a B&B, rent a 4X4 and go exploring Mayan ruins. For us it's a great double vacation. Driving in Belize is a lot of fun and easy. Also a visit to the Belize Zoo is more than worth the time. More like being in the jungle than in a zoo. Nice to have our own vehicle instead of the tour busses and being under time constraints.

Not much other than diving going on on Bonaire. This spring we're going back to either Belize or Honduras for a weeks dive and then a week of archeology excursion.

One last Belize observation - Best Chinese food we've had in all our travels. It was surprising !

The AJ flights run in the $400 to $700 range depending on who knows what. I just looked at Atl to Bon in March and the price was $640. If I remember correctly AJ only flies to Bon on Sat. A travel agent may be able to do better. Call Air Jamacia or use the web site. Another option is AA. Fly them into PR then on to Bonaire. You might also try looking at flights into Aruba or Curacao on AA,Delta or United and then grab Divi or Bonaire Excel into Bonaire (around $100RT).
